summaryrefslogtreecommitdiffstats
path: root/third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-19 01:13:27 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2024-04-19 01:13:27 +0000
commit40a355a42d4a9444dc753c04c6608dade2f06a23 (patch)
tree871fc667d2de662f171103ce5ec067014ef85e61 /third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c
parentAdding upstream version 124.0.1. (diff)
downloadfirefox-adbda400be353e676059e335c3c0aaf99e719475.tar.xz
firefox-adbda400be353e676059e335c3c0aaf99e719475.zip
Adding upstream version 125.0.1.upstream/125.0.1
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c')
-rw-r--r--third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c33
1 files changed, 0 insertions, 33 deletions
diff --git a/third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c b/third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c
index 5a8c7a27a7..b69e066039 100644
--- a/third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c
+++ b/third_party/libwebrtc/p2p/base/basic_async_resolver_factory.cc
@@ -15,20 +15,11 @@
#include "absl/memory/memory.h"
#include "api/async_dns_resolver.h"
-#include "api/wrapping_async_dns_resolver.h"
#include "rtc_base/async_dns_resolver.h"
-#include "rtc_base/async_resolver.h"
#include "rtc_base/logging.h"
namespace webrtc {
-#pragma clang diagnostic push
-#pragma clang diagnostic ignored "-Wdeprecated-declarations"
-rtc::AsyncResolverInterface* BasicAsyncResolverFactory::Create() {
- return new rtc::AsyncResolver();
-}
-#pragma clang diagnostic pop
-
std::unique_ptr<webrtc::AsyncDnsResolverInterface>
BasicAsyncDnsResolverFactory::Create() {
return std::make_unique<AsyncDnsResolver>();
@@ -53,28 +44,4 @@ BasicAsyncDnsResolverFactory::CreateAndResolve(
return resolver;
}
-std::unique_ptr<webrtc::AsyncDnsResolverInterface>
-WrappingAsyncDnsResolverFactory::Create() {
- return std::make_unique<WrappingAsyncDnsResolver>(wrapped_factory_->Create());
-}
-
-std::unique_ptr<webrtc::AsyncDnsResolverInterface>
-WrappingAsyncDnsResolverFactory::CreateAndResolve(
- const rtc::SocketAddress& addr,
- absl::AnyInvocable<void()> callback) {
- std::unique_ptr<webrtc::AsyncDnsResolverInterface> resolver = Create();
- resolver->Start(addr, std::move(callback));
- return resolver;
-}
-
-std::unique_ptr<webrtc::AsyncDnsResolverInterface>
-WrappingAsyncDnsResolverFactory::CreateAndResolve(
- const rtc::SocketAddress& addr,
- int family,
- absl::AnyInvocable<void()> callback) {
- std::unique_ptr<webrtc::AsyncDnsResolverInterface> resolver = Create();
- resolver->Start(addr, family, std::move(callback));
- return resolver;
-}
-
} // namespace webrtc